Cornucopia is neat. I wrote a similar library in Go [1] so I'm very interested in comparing design decisions.
The pros of the generated code per query approach:
- App code is coupled to query outputs and inputs (an API of sorts), not database tables. Therefore, you can refactor your DB without changing app code.
- Real SQL with the full breadth of DB features.
- Real type-checking with what the DB supports.
The cons:
- Type mapping is surprisingly hard to get right, especially with composite types and arrays and custom type converters. For example, a query might return multiple jsonb columns but the app code wants to parse them into different structs.
- Dynamic queries don't work with prepared statements. Prepared statements only support values, not identifiers or scalar SQL sub-queries, so the codegen layer needs a mechanism to template SQL. I haven't built this out yet but would like to.

ORM as a term covers a wide swathe of usage. In the smallest definition, an ORM converts DB tuples to Go structs. In common usage, most folks use ORM to mean a generic query builder plus the type conversion from tuples to structs. For other usages, I prefer the Patterns of Enterprise Application Architecture terms [1] like data-mapper, active record, and table-data gateway.

pggen occupies the same design space as sqlc but the implementations are quite different. Sqlc figures out the query types using type inference in Go which is nice because you don’t need Postgres at build time. Pggen asks Postgres what the query types are which is nice because it works with any extensions and arbitrarily complex queries.

You might like the approach I took with pggen[1] which was inspired by sqlc[2]. You write a SQL query in regular SQL and the tool generates a type-safe Go querier struct with a method for each query.
The primary benefit of pggen and sqlc is that you don't need a different query model; it's just SQL and the tools automate the mapping between database rows and Go structs.

I'm pretty picky regarding query builders and ORM's, to the extent of having written several of them over the years, in different languages (both dynamic and strong typed, unfortunately closed-source). I'm a strong advocate of schema-first design, and usually a query builder will allow you to design your queries explicitly, but having some internal behaviors (such as string concatenation, identifier quoting and automatic in-order separation of parameters and values to be bound) taken care of. As good examples of this, I'd mention golang's goqu (https://github.com/doug-martin/goqu) and - to some extent - C# SqlKata (https://sqlkata.com/). Your code generates raw SQL, so it's 100% interchangeable with writing SQL yourself however the builder library deals with the syntax, proper ordering, quoting, full attribute names, etc. Some such libraries even let you define your schema in code to make your SQL generation type safe.
